Its primary function is to retract the anterior wall of the vagina, improving both visibility and access for the surgeon. This instrument has a unique curved design with a broad blade, making it particularly effective at exposing the cervix or vaginal walls during examinations or surgeries, such as vaginal hysterectomies, repair of vaginal prolapse, and Pap smears. The handle is ergonomically shaped, enabling the user to maintain control while minimizing patient discomfort.When selecting or using a Sims anterior wall retractor, it's essential to consider patient anatomy, procedure specifics, and the possibility of tissue trauma from prolonged retraction. The instrument is typically made from high-grade stainless steel for durability and ease of sterilization. Proper technique is vital—not only for optimal visualization but also for patient safety and comfort.
